WebTech Wireless Quadrant System Supports the State of Texas and the Governor's Division of Emergency Management Evacuation Efforts
Evacuation communication kits use WebTech Wireless locators and service to help keep track of evacuation residents

By: Marketwire .
Aug. 30, 2007 11:00 AM

VANCOUVER, BRITISH COLUMBIA -- (MARKET WIRE) -- 08/30/07 -- WebTech Wireless Inc. (TSX: WEW), a provider of location-based and fleet Telematics services, confirmed today that it provided the National Guard in Texas with the WebTech Wireless(TM) Quadrant(TM) system as part of the National Guard's evacuation communication system designed to keep track of evacuated residents, as part of preparation for natural disasters such as Hurricane Dean earlier this month.

As Hurricane Dean was building in strength, the National Guard began preparations for its emergency evacuation procedure which includes allocating Radio-Frequency Identification (RFID) tags to keep track of people, pets and medical supplies in the event of evacuation. The system ensures that if evacuation is required, the location of evacuated residents would always be known, preventing the separation and detachment of families that caused major problems during Hurricanes Rita and Katrina.

The State's National Guard equipped buses with evacuation communication kits in portable cases that included the WebTech Wireless WT5000(TM) Locator, as well as a laptop, external vehicle battery, cigarette lighter adaptor, Symbol RFID reader and cellular phone. The WT5000 Locators are activated on the AT&T GSM/GPRS/EDGE cellular network to ensure a reliable communication signal. Each person, pet or medical supply kit assigned with an RFID tag has their information entered into a central database as they board evacuation buses. The WT5000 Locator then transmits the exact location of each bus every minute, enabling the Quadrant system to update the database and allow administrators to keep track of evacuees.

"The WebTech Wireless Quadrant system was demonstrated as part of evacuation exercises conducted by the State of Texas, Governor's Division of Emergency Management in July 2006 and June 2007, the success of which has led to this latest deployment," said Anwar Sukkarie, President and CEO of WebTech Wireless. "Our experience supplying emergency departments such as fire, ambulance and police enable us to confidently deploy Quadrant for these critical evacuation procedures. Whether it is a natural disaster or a matter for Homeland Security, we look forward to helping others prepare for emergency and life threatening situations."

The initial order was for delivery of 1100 portable WT5000 Locators in August, with further expansion of the service possible in Texas and other hurricane affected regions.

About WebTech Wireless Inc.

WebTech Wireless Inc. (TSX: WEW) is a global Telematics, location-based services provider that develops, manufactures, and delivers turnkey wireless solutions designed to improve productivity and profitability. WebTech Wireless products include wireless hardware and software services running on cellular and satellite networks, and include Automatic Vehicle Location, Mapping, Reporting, Vehicle Diagnostics, Driver Status, In-vehicle Telemetry, Messaging, In-vehicle Navigation, and wireless application and Internet connectivity. WebTech Wireless is currently providing devices and services worldwide in eight languages to over forty-one countries covering five continents. WebTech Wireless' scalable solutions are used by a broad range of small, medium and Fortune 500 companies and by governments. For more information, please visit www.webtechwireless.com.
